Ultrasound Technician Job Description

Henryetta OK sonographer testing pregnant womanThere are multiple professional tit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also referred to as sonogram techs, di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ers) and ultrasound technologists. Regardless of name, they all have the same primary job description, which is to perform diagnostic ultrasound testing on patients. Although many work as generalists there are specializations within the profession, for example in cardiology and pediatrics. The majority practice in Henryetta OK clinics, hospitals, outpatient diagnostic imaging centers and even private practices. Common daily job functions of an ultrasound tech can consist of:

  • Maintaining records of patient medical histories and specifics of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Preparing the ultrasound machines for use and then cleaning and re-calibrating them
  • Transferring patients to treatment rooms and making them comfortable
  • Using equipment while minimizing patient exposure to sound waves
  • Evaluating results and identifying necessity for supplemental testing

Ultrasound techs must routinely evaluate the performance and safety of their equipment. They also must adhere to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as medical practitioners. In order to sustain that level of professionalism and remain current with medical knowledge, they are required to complete continuing education training on a regular basis.

Ultrasound Technician Degrees Offered

Henryetta OK ultrasound tech testing pregnant womanSonogram technician enrollees have the opportunity to acquire either an Associate or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will normally involve about 18 months to 2 years to finish dependent on the course load and program. A Bachelor’s Degree will take longer at up to four years to complete. Another option for individuals who have previously obtained a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have received a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a relevant medical field, you can enroll in a certificate program that will require just 12 to 18 months to complete. Something to consider is that almost all ultrasound technician schools do have a clinical training component as a portion of their course of study. It often may be satisfied by participating in an internship program which numerous colleges organize with Henryetta OK clinics and hospitals. Once you have graduated from any of the degree or certificate programs, you will then have to comply with the licensing or certification requirements in Oklahoma or whatever state you choose to practice in.

Are the Sonogram Tech Programs Accredited? Most sonogram tech colleges have received some type of accreditation, whether national or regional. Nevertheless, it’s still important to verify that the program and school are accredited. Among the most highly respected acc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Programs obtaining acc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through a rigorous review of their instructors and course materials. If the college is online it can also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ets online or distance learning. All accrediting organizations should be rec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. In addition to ensuring a superior education, accreditation will also help in obtaining financial aid and student loans, which are often not offered for non-accredited schools. Accreditation may also be a pre-requisite for licensing and certification as required. And numerous Henryetta OK employers will only hire graduates of an accredited program for entry-level jobs.

Henryetta, Oklahoma

Hugh Henry established a ranch on Creek Nation land in 1885. He soon found a deposit of coal, which he began using to fuel the forge at his ranch. Discovery of more coal deposits attracted several railroads to develop these mines. A settlement named Furrs grew up around the mines. The name changed to Henryetta when a post office opened on August 28, 1900.[4]

At statehood in 1907, Henryetta had 1,051 residents. The economy was based on agriculture, coal, natural gas and oil. In 1909, the area had fourteen coal mines, producing 65,000 tons per month. By 1910, the population had grown to 1,671. The town added a broom factory, several brick factories and a bottling plant during the 1920s.[4]

Henryetta's manufacturing base continued to expand in the 1940s and 1950s. Pittsburgh Plate Glass Company (now PPG Industries) employed nine hundred people at its plate glass production facility, which claimed to be the largest west of the Mississippi River. This plant closed by 1990. Eagle-Picher Company employed more than seven hundred people at its plant that extracted the rare metal germanium.[4] The plant has since closed and became a Superfund cleanup site.

According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 6.1 square miles (16 km2), of which, 6.0 square miles (16 km2) of it is land and 0.04 square miles (0.10 km2) of it (0.66%) is water.

Ultrasound technician programs require that you have a high school diploma or a GED. In addition to meeting academic standards, you must be in at least reasonably good physical health, able to stand for lengthy periods with the ability to routinely lift weights of 50 pounds or more, as is it often necessary to adjust patients and move heavy machinery. Other preferred talents include technical aptitude, the ability to stay levelheaded when faced with an anxious or angry patient and the ability to communicate in a clear and compassionate manner.
